The Marrowbay product catalog caches item pages in the Fenchurch cache layer for fifteen minutes. Invalidation is event-driven: any price or stock edit publishes an expiry message, and the cache nodes drop the affected keys within seconds. If a customer reports stale prices beyond that window, the invalidation consumer has likely stalled — restart it before escalating. To verify whether the underlying record actually changed, support can query the catalog database read replica directly using the connection string below.

primary connection of tajeg-tajop = postgresql://julax_svc:DI@db-e7f3.kelvidyn.corp:5432/rusdor

## Authentication

Compactor access goes through the Lorridge internal gateway. Every call to the compaction API on Quillstream must carry a service key in the request header. No key, no compaction stats, no segment purge. Keys are scoped per environment; staging and prod never share. Do not reuse the contractor sandbox key for anything touching live topics — compaction deletes data and mistakes are permanent. Request scope changes through the platform channel. The current staging key is below.

gateway credential: kto23_LX9A4ys6i4nzHtpOLNLodKK

## Escalation: UI Snapshot Test Failures

When snapshot diffs appear in the Glimmerkit component suite, first confirm whether a deliberate visual change landed this sprint; if so, the author regenerates baselines in their own branch, never on main. Unexplained diffs affecting three or more components suggest a rendering-engine bump and should be escalated within one business day. Attach the diff artifacts and the failing commit range to the escalation ticket. Route all escalations to the design-systems rotation here.

escalation mailbox, yajeg-bageg: quenax.olidor@lumiccorp.internal

Subject: DR Drill — Canary Gating Rules. Hi Orla, during Thursday's drill at the Fennick site, canary deploys will gate on error-rate deltas above 0.5% and latency regressions past the 95th percentile, exactly as in production. Please review the gating config before we start. Should the drill controller lock out mid-exercise, restore access with the recovery passphrase below.

strongbox words: istwyn-normir-silwyn-ulaius-istwyn